Calibrating a pendulum is relatively easy. Simply hold your pendulum in your receptive (usually left) hand and keep your elbow braced so there is no strain in keeping the pendulum suspended. Next, concentrate on the pendulum and ask it (effectively you are asking your subconscious) out loud to show you its "yes". Next ask it to show you its "no".
These are the most basic results that you will need. If you wish you can also try calibrating the pendulum with "maybe" or "I don't know" etc. Or anything else that you think you may find useful.
Each time you ask the pendulum to show you its movement, watch carefully to see which direction (or how) it moves. This may be movement to the left, the right, away from you, towards you, circular in either direction etc. The movements may be very, very, slight to start with, but as you become more in tune with the pendulum and your higher self the movements will become stronger and more definite. Don't try and force the movements because they seem small.
Once you have calibrated your pendulum try it out with simple questions to which you know the answer.
It is a good idea to calibrate the pendulum before each session. Although you will probably find that nothing has changed it pays to make sure. The last thing you want to do is to wrongly interpret an answer when the issue at hand is important.
